Summary of the comparison

St. George's Primary School & St. George's Nursery School, Great Yarmouth and Edward Worlledge Ormiston Academy are primary schools in Great Yarmouth.

  • St. George's Primary School & St. George's Nursery School, Great Yarmouth scores 37 out of 100 (grade F, weak) and Edward Worlledge Ormiston Academy scores 37 out of 100 (grade F, weak). Our score is the same for each of them on the data available.

  • St. George's Primary School & St. George's Nursery School, Great Yarmouth was judged Good and Edward Worlledge Ormiston Academy was judged Good.

  • On the share of pupils meeting the expected standard in reading, writing and maths at Key Stage 2, the latest published figures are 30.0% for St. George's Primary School & St. George's Nursery School, Great Yarmouth and 49.0% for Edward Worlledge Ormiston Academy.

  • The share of pupils meeting the expected standard at Key Stage 2 has held broadly level at St. George's Primary School & St. George's Nursery School, Great Yarmouth (31.0% in 2022-23, 30.0% in 2024-25) and has risen at Edward Worlledge Ormiston Academy (28.0% in 2022-23, 49.0% in 2024-25).
